Geography and Accessibility of Phuket & Pattaya
Location
Phuket is a beautiful island in the Andaman Sea. It has amazing beaches and clear blue water, making it perfect for people who love nature. Its tropical beauty attracts visitors from all over the world. Pattaya, on the other hand, is a lively city by the Gulf of Thailand. It is known for its energetic atmosphere, beaches, and exciting city life. Both places offer different experiences for travelers, depending on what they enjoy.
Accessibility
Getting to Phuket is easy because it has an international airport with flights from many countries. This makes traveling there simple. Pattaya is close to Bangkok, so you can reach it by road or from Bangkok’s airports. Its short distance from the capital makes it a popular choice for weekend trips. Whether you prefer flying to Phuket or the quick road trip to Pattaya, both destinations are easy to visit.
Weather & Climate Comparison of Phuket & Pattaya
Both Phuket and Pattaya have tropical weather, but their climates are a little different. Phuket has a strong rainy season from May to October, with heavy rains. Its dry season, from November to April, is sunny and perfect for the beach. Pattaya also has a rainy season from May to October, but it gets less rain than Phuket. Like Phuket, Pattaya has a dry season from November to April, with clear skies and nice weather. The dry months are the best time to visit both places. Whether you like Phuket’s green landscapes or Pattaya’s lighter rains, visiting at the right time will make your trip special.

Travel Cost Comparison of Both Destinations: Phuket vs Pattaya
Phuket and Pattaya have different price ranges. Accommodation in Phuket can be expensive, especially for fancy beach resorts. Pattaya, on the other hand, has cheaper options like budget hotels and guesthouses.
Food in both places can fit any budget. Street food is cheap and delicious in both cities. In Phuket, transportation costs more because public transport is limited. Taxis and rentals are common there. In Pattaya, shared songthaews (trucks) are cheaper to travel in.
Activities in Phuket, like island tours and water sports, are usually more expensive. Pattaya’s nightlife and local attractions tend to cost less. Plan your trip based on your budget and what you like to do.

Best Time to Visit Both The Places Phuket and PattayaÂ
The best time to visit Phuket and Pattaya depends on the weather and what you enjoy doing. Phuket is best from November to February when the weather is sunny, and the beaches are perfect for relaxing. The monsoon season, from May to October, has lots of rain but fewer tourists. Pattaya is good to visit all year since it gets less rain. The best time to visit Pattaya is from November to March when the weather is nice for outdoor fun, beaches, and nightlife. If you want fewer crowds and better prices, avoid the busy holiday season. Plan ahead for a great trip! Transportation Option, Phuket vs Pattaya
Getting around in both Phuket vs Pattaya is easy, but the cities have different ways to travel. In Pattaya, songthaews (shared pickup trucks) are the most common and affordable choice. They follow regular routes and are great for getting around. Motorbike taxis are available for short trips. If you want more freedom, you can rent a motorbike or a car. Traffic is usually light, except during busy times.
In Phuket, there are tuk-tuks, taxis, and motorbike rentals. Tuk-tuks and taxis cost more than in Pattaya. Renting a scooter is popular for exploring the beaches and scenic spots. Public transport is limited, so many tourists rent vehicles or use private transfers. Traffic can get heavy, especially in Patong or during peak seasons.
Overall, Pattaya is more budget-friendly, while Phuket offers scenic routes for a more beautiful travel experience. Both cities are easy to explore, depending on your needs.
